What is Unified Inbox?

A single shared workspace where a team handles all WhatsApp (and other channel) conversations.

A unified inbox is a shared interface where multiple agents can view, manage, and reply to conversations from one or more WhatsApp numbers — and often from other channels like Instagram and Messenger — in one place. Because the API has no built-in interface, a unified inbox is how teams actually work with WhatsApp.

It supports assigning chats to agents, internal notes, tags, status tracking, and seeing the full history of each customer. This lets several people serve one number simultaneously without conflicts, something the single-device app cannot do.

A unified inbox is essential for support and sales teams that need collaboration, accountability, and a complete view of every customer conversation.
